当前位置: 首页 > news >正文

【pyenv】pyenv安装版本超时的解决方案

目录

1、现象

2、分析现象 

3、手动下载所需版本

4、存放到指定路径

5、重新安装 

6、pip失败(做个记录,未找到原因)

7、方法二修改环境变量方法

7.1 设置环境变量

 7.2 更新

7.3 安装即可

8、方法三修改XML文件


前言:研究了一下pyenv结果发现下载安装版本老是超时,临时找了一个方案

1、现象

 

2、分析现象 

上面很明显看出是下载到指定路径超时,那么我是不是可以手动下载到指定目录呢

3、手动下载所需版本

(那个慢,其实这里也会慢,特殊方法下载到的)

我是Windows 系统64位,打开 Index of /ftp/python/ 找到需要安装的版本,然后下载  python-3.8.3-amd64.exe

4、存放到指定路径

下载之后然后放到 pyenv 本地路径里面的 【.pyenv\pyenv-win\install_cache】文件夹中

5、重新安装 

pyenv install 3.8.10

很明显直接安装了,完美 

6、设置全局版本

pyenv global 3.8.10

6、pip失败(做个记录,未找到原因)

 pyenv activate 3.8.10 虽然失败了,但是之前执行升级都没有反应

7、方法二修改环境变量方法

7.1 设置环境变量

PYTHON_BUILD_MIRROR_URL=https://jedore.netlify.app/tools/python-mirrors/
或
PYTHON_BUILD_MIRROR_URL=https://jedore.vercel.app/tools/python-mirrors/

 7.2 更新

pyenv update

7.3 安装即可

8、方法三修改XML文件

用vscode打开C:\Users\16123\.pyenv\pyenv-win\.versions_cache.xml

查找https://www.python.org/ftp/python,并将其替换为https://npm.taobao.org/mirrors/python

http://www.lryc.cn/news/438697.html

相关文章:

  • 【新片场-注册安全分析报告-无验证方式导致安全隐患】
  • 新160个crackme - 057-bbbs-crackme04
  • 车机中 Android Audio 音频常见问题分析方法实践小结
  • 湘大 OJ 代码仓库
  • Ruoyi Cloud K8s 部署
  • OpenGL Texture C++ Camera Filter滤镜
  • 基于Sobel算法的边缘检测设计与实现
  • java:练习
  • 大数据中一些常用的集群启停命令
  • Golang、Python、C语言、Java的圆桌会议
  • C语言编译原理
  • 【c++】类和对象(下)(取地址运算符重载、深究构造函数、类型转换、static修饰成员、友元、内部类、匿名对象)
  • Apache POI 学习
  • 福建科立讯通信 指挥调度管理平台 SQL注入漏洞
  • 4.qml单例模式
  • CACTI 0.8.7 迁移并升级到 1.2.7记录
  • OrionX vGPU 研发测试场景下最佳实践之Jupyter模式
  • 国风编曲:了解国风 民族调式 五声音阶 作/编曲思路 变化音 六声、七声调式
  • HTTP 响应状态码详解
  • 在服务器上开Juypter Lab教程(远程访问)
  • 【硬件模块】SHT20温湿度传感器
  • Redhat 8,9系(复刻系列) 一键部署Oracle23ai rpm
  • SIPp uac.xml 之我见
  • 引领智能家居新风尚,WTN6040F门铃解决方案——让家的呼唤更动听
  • Android 蓝牙服务启动
  • 【安全系列--处理挖矿】
  • SpringBoot集成Thymeleaf模板引擎,为什么使用(详细介绍)
  • Docker突然宣布:涨价80%
  • 工厂方法模式和抽象工厂模式
  • 【星海出品】go语言环境兼install